Known as the “Crossroads of Kansas,” Salina, Kansas features the blend of big-city amenities with a small-town charm. The town was founded in 1858, and it was named after the Saline River, which runs through the area. Salina thrives itself from its strong arts scene, as well as its abundance of outdoor activities. Salina is home to the Wildlife Museum at Rolling Hills Zoo which features a wide variety of animals from around the world, including elephants, lions, and giraffes. The town is also known for its aviation history, and it is home to the Smoky Hill Air National Guard Range and the Salina Regional Airport.
If you are looking for an outdoor adventure, Salina offers the Indian Rock Park which shows off unique rock formations and has a breath-taking scenic view for any nature lovers out there.
